How much does it cost to rent an apartment in 90063?
Bedroom | Average Rent | Cheapest Rent | Highest Rent |
---|---|---|---|
90063 Studio Apartments | $1,600 | $1,600 | $1,600 |
90063 1 Bedroom Apartments | $1,918 | $1,673 | $2,395 |
90063 2 Bedroom Apartments | $2,361 | $1,895 | $3,350 |
90063 3 Bedroom Apartments | $3,046 | $2,800 | $3,195 |
90063 4 Bedroom Apartments | $3,933 | $3,800 | $4,000 |

Frequently Asked Questions about Utilities Included the 90063 ZIP Code Apartments
How much is the average rent for a Utilities Included 90063 Apartment?
The average rent for a Utilities Included Apartment in 90063 is $1,545.
What is the largest Utilities Included 90063 Apartment for rent?
Today's Utilities Included apartment with the most square footage in 90063 is a 1,400 square feet unit starting from $1,295 at Laurelwood Oaks.
What is the average size for 90063 Utilities Included Apartments for rent?
The average size for a Utilities Included rental in 90063 is currently at 650 sq ft.
